A PET preform is the starting point of every plastic bottle you see in the market. Before the final shape is created, manufacturers use this small tube-like structure to form bottles through heat and air pressure. This is why the PET preform manufacturing process plays a critical role in determining the final product quality.
Many buyers face issues like bottle leakage, deformation, or inconsistent thickness. In most cases, the root cause is not the bottle but the preform itself. Poor preform quality leads to weak bottles, higher rejection rates, and increased production cost. Understanding how PET bottles are made helps businesses avoid these problems at the sourcing stage.

Advanced machinery plays a major role in improving consistency. Modern systems like Husky and ASB machines are designed to maintain precise control over temperature, pressure, and cycle time.
This reduces variation in production and ensures uniform thickness and strength across all preforms. For businesses dealing with high-volume production, consistent output is essential to avoid downtime and wastage.

PET bottles are made by reheating preforms and expanding them using air pressure inside a mould. This process shapes the preform into the final bottle.
Injection moulding PET preform is the process where melted PET resin is injected into moulds to create preforms with precise shape and dimensions.
